Sana’a Send Fiery Warnings to Coalition about Violations of Truce

The spokesman of Sana’a forces, Brigadier General Yahya Sarie, warned on Saturday the Saudi-led coalition of the consequences of its continuous violations of the armistice announced by the United Nations last month.

Sarie during his visit along with military leaders to the fighters stationed on Al-Jouba and Al-Balaq fronts, south of Marib city, confirmed that “the coalition began to renounce the implementation of the truce in its required form, and showed its real face, which is characterized by evasiveness, cunning, deception and criminality.

He pointed out that the Yemeni people are facing defining moments in history, “either the enemy shows its seriousness about the truce, or it reneges, as it is usual.”
